Why Clutter Creates Bigger Problems Than Most Investors Expect
What looks like "just junk" often turns into a chain of delays. A broken couch in the living room can block flooring repairs. A stack of tenant leftovers can hide water damage. Old appliances can make it harder to see whether an electrical or plumbing issue needs attention.
That is especially true in properties where abandonment, eviction, or foreclosure created a messy handoff and the unit needs to be brought back to market quickly.
There is also the issue of carrying costs. Every extra week can mean another mortgage payment, another utility bill, more insurance exposure, and more lost rent potential.
